Lower-stress care for dogs starts at homeSeptember 28, 2022Recent years have seen veterinary clinics make great strides to alleviate patient stress during routine exams and procedures. Notably, many clinics have taken measures to provide stress alleviation for pets through various desensitization and counterconditioning techniques. This may include having treats on-hand as a positive distraction, providing separate waiting areas for dogs and cats, and timing appointments to allow nervous pets to bypass waiting areas and go directly into an exam room.
